@charset "UTF-8";

/*
■目次 --------------------------------------------------- 
[recruitディレクトリ用 ]
更新日：2006/08/30 nagai

[01]:採用お問い合わせページ[/recruit/contact/]
[02]:お問い合わせページ[/contact/]

========================================================== */



/* [01]:採用お問い合わせページ[/recruit/contact/] */
/* ------------------------------------------------------------------------- */

	div.recruitContents {
		width: 525px;
		margin: 25px 0px 0px  18px;
	}

	table.recruitForm {
		width: 525px;
		margin-top: 8px;
		border: 0px;
		border-collapse: collapse;
		background-color: #FFFFFF;
	}

	table.recruitForm th {
		vertical-align: top;
		text-align: left;
		width: 180px;
		padding: 7px 0px 0px 7px;
		border-left: 7px solid #E7E7E7;
		font-weight: normal;
	}

	table.recruitForm td {
		width: 315px;
		padding: 5px 8px;
		background-color: #F6F6F6;
	}

	table.recruitForm td.non {
		width: 525px;
		height: 1px;
		padding: 0px;
		margin: 0px;
		border-left: 0px;
		background-color: #FFFFFF;
	}

	table.privacy {
		width: 525px;
		margin: 15px 0px;
		border-right: 1px solid #999999;
		border-left: 1px solid #999999;
		border-bottom: 1px solid #999999;
		border-collapse: collapse;
		background-color: #FFFFFF;
	}

	table.privacy th {
		text-align: left;
		width: 513px;
		padding: 3px 0px 3px 10px;
		background-color: #999999;
		color: #FFFFFF;
		font-weight: normal;
	}

	table.privacy td {
		width: 483px;
		padding: 10px 15px;
	}

	p.privacyTextLeft {
		float: left;
		width: 14px;
		padding-left: 10px;
		padding-right: 10px;
	}

	p.privacyTextRight {
		float: left;
		width: 449px;
	}

	div.recruitFormSubmit {
		margin-left: 63px;
	}


/* [02]:お問い合わせページ[/contact/] */
/* ------------------------------------------------------------------------- */

	div.contactContents {
		width: 525px;
		margin: 25px 0px 0px  18px;
	}

	table.contactForm {
		width: 525px;
		margin-top: 8px;
		border: 0px;
		border-collapse: collapse;
		background-color: #FFFFFF;
	}

	table.contactForm th {
		vertical-align: top;
		text-align: left;
		width: 180px;
		padding: 7px 0px 0px 7px;
		border-left: 7px solid #7D7D7D;
		font-weight: normal;
	}

	table.contactForm td {
		width: 315px;
		padding: 5px 8px;
		background-color: #F0F3F9;
	}

	table.contactForm td.non {
		width: 525px;
		height: 1px;
		padding: 0px;
		margin: 0px;
		border-left: 0px;
		background-color: #FFFFFF;
	}

	div.contactFormSubmit {
		margin-left: 63px;
	}

/* ------------------------------------------------------------------------- */

